The authors—Beer and Johnston—are practically synonymous with engineering mechanics. Their approach to teaching Statics and Dynamics set the stage for how mechanics is taught globally. With the inclusion of DeWolf and Mazurek in later editions, the text has evolved to incorporate modern computational methods while retaining the rigorous theoretical foundation that purists admire. The book is published in English as Mechanics of Materials and translated into Spanish by McGraw-Hill Interamericana. The 7th edition translation is widely praised for maintaining the technical precision of the original English text.
In the world of engineering education, few textbooks hold the legendary status of "Mecánica de Materiales" (Mechanics of Materials) by Ferdinand P. Beer, E. Russell Johnston, Jr., John T. DeWolf, and David F. Mazurek. For students pursuing degrees in Civil, Mechanical, Industrial, or Aerospace engineering, the 7th Edition is often considered the "gold standard" for understanding the internal behavior of solid objects under stress and strain.
